    The US housing market has experienced significant fluctuations in recent years, with prices skyrocketing in many areas. This has led to increased mortgage debt and a growing concern among homeowners about their financial security. Mortgage protection insurance can provide peace of mind for borrowers, ensuring that their mortgage payments are covered in the event of an unexpected life event. As more Americans become aware of this option, its popularity is likely to continue growing.

      • Mortgage protection insurance is a type of life insurance that is specifically designed to cover mortgage payments. If the policyholder dies, becomes disabled, or experiences a serious illness, the insurance policy pays out a lump sum to cover outstanding mortgage payments. This can be a significant financial burden lifted from the shoulders of loved ones, allowing them to focus on grief or recovery rather than financial stress.

    Mortgage protection insurance typically covers death, disability, or serious illness, such as cancer or a heart attack.

    If you already have life insurance, you may not need mortgage protection insurance. However, if your life insurance policy does not cover mortgage payments, mortgage protection insurance may be a valuable addition.
